CAL CABS TO HUNT DOWN FROM 2005 “Make no mistake, California 2005 Cabs are juicy, full-flavoured and potent, yet many of them show restraint…Warm, spicy, berry nose. Fine, plum jam, spicy notes. Plenty of weight. Firm, crisp tannins. Nice length…has the structure and moderate alcohol (13.6%) to age for years. Blackcurrant, Christmas spice, tobacco... Closes with succulence and crispness.” Corison, Napa Valley "5 Stars" Decanter Magazine 2008
TOP 100 WINES 2008 - San Francisco Chronicle"Cathy Corison coaxed a smoky, anise-tinged effort from the 2005 vintage. Balanced, fresh and ripe, with sweet black fruit, plum graphite and a big grippy finish, very much in line with her more structured, firmly tannic and age worthy approach."
2005 Corison Napa Valley Cabernet Sauvignon ... 95 points Wine Enthusiast, February 2009
Stephen Tanzer's International Wine Cellar: Good full ruby-red. Musky aromas of dried cherry, cedar, fresh herbs, incense and tobacco. Dense, juicy and fine-grained, with lovely verve to its delineated flavors of raspberry, spices, loam, leather and herbs. Finishes ripe and long but delicate, with nicely integrated acidity, understated sweetness and fine tannins that dust the front teeth. Mouth-filling Cabernet without any undue weight, a bit in the style of the '08 91 pts Stephen Tanzer, September 2012
